Susan Bal, MD presents MILESTONE Trial: MRD Adapted Deferral of Transplant in Dysproteinemia at IMS 2024

Hi, I'm Susan Baal at the University of Alabama at Birmingham, and I was delighted to share the first results from an investigator-initiated phase two trial of measurable residual disease or MRD-adapted deferral of transplant in dysprotinemia, also known as the milestone clinical trial. So this is a small pilot feasibility study, essentially trying to understand what we can use MRD that we obtained following induction treatment for newly diagnosed multiple myeloma patients and use that MRD result to make the decision about whether or not we should proceed with transplant. So the primary endpoint of our study was to understand if we can use MRD as a strategy to make transplant decisions. So what we did is we included 20 patients, about 50% of our patients were male, 50% of those were over the ages of 70. We had about 15% high risk and up to 40% if you add a gain of 1q, and we had up to 45% racial and ethnic minorities. So this was a very diverse population. What we saw was very impressive results in terms of the initial MRD response following induction was 25%, and all of those patients per protocol were able to defer a transplant. Following their consolidation therapy, we saw that the MRD responses increased to 55%, and then the best response overall in terms of MRD on the entire study was 65%. So using a quadruplet standard combination of DERA-VRD for induction for six cycles, we were able to allow a quarter of our patients to defer transplant knowing that they had had a deep enough response even if they were good candidates. All of those patients did proceed with stem cell collection, so in the future they still have the option of going through transplant, but what we are showing is with the best MRD response with a two-year follow-up of 65%, that you can have equivalent outcomes as receiving a quadruplet and transplant and then still defer it and have similar outcomes, which is huge for our patients because transplant has so many toxicities such as, you know, mucusitis, difficulty eating, weight loss, hair loss, low blood count, staying in the hospital for a period of time, risk of infections, and then longer term side effects such as a proportion of patients will have a higher risk of hematologic cancers that can occur in the later period. So, you know, it's really not something that most of our patients want to go through, but occasionally they feel compelled because of the increased depth and duration of response, but now with this MRD adapted strategy, we for the first time have an opportunity to make an informed decision with our patients about the risk and benefit ratio. Now, of course, you know, we'll have to see if the longer term follow-up outcomes are similar, but this is now being tested in the context of two large randomized clinical trials, the ongoing MIDAS trial whose results we'll hear at this meeting, as well as the Master II trial that is now open at UAB. So, this also helped us understand whether the Master II trial would be feasible in many ways and see if six cycles of induction therapy would still lead to adequate stem cell output as well as help us make a real-time decision using MRD.
